Interface web moderna (Rust + Leptos SSR/CSR) para operação Bacula Community: dashboard com cartão do Director, listas de Storages/Clients/Jobs com LEDs de status, jobs de restore, painel das últimas 24h, multilíngue (PT-BR/EN). Substitui Baculum/Bweb com UX contemporânea e telemetria nativa.
O que faz
- Dashboard operacional — Cartão do Director (nome + versão + LED verde/amarelo/vermelho), Storages/Clients/Jobs colapsáveis.
- Jobs com chain colors — Lista de jobs com cores indicando sucesso encadeado e ícone de plugin/arquivo (cache 60s).
- Restore + 24h panel — Lista de execuções de restore com LEDs de status; painel das últimas 24 horas em detalhe.
- Stack moderna — Rust + Leptos (SSR + hydration); pacote único; deploy em VM ou container; telemetria Prometheus.
Diferenciais
| Recurso | Bacula Community sozinho | Bacula Enterprise / Veeam | PodHeitor |
|---|---|---|---|
| Recurso ativo no Bacula Community | Não | Sim ($$) | Sim, sem licença extra |
| Implementação | — | C++ / Perl proprietário | Rust memory-safe |
| Observabilidade nativa | Limitada | Limitada | Prometheus + dashboard ao vivo |
| Custo | Grátis (sem suporte) | $$$$ | ≥ 50% mais barato que Enterprise/Veeam |
Compatibilidade
- Bacula Community 15.0.3+
- Linux x86_64 (Debian 12 / OL 9 testados)
- Browser moderno (Chrome, Firefox, Safari)
- Idiomas: PT-BR e EN (ES em desenvolvimento)
Instalação rápida
Binário Rust único + diretório site/. Pacote systemd via instalador. Deploy demo em http://192.168.15.120:3001 (lab).
Pronto para mudar?
Traga sua proposta de renovação ou contratação do Bacula Enterprise, Veeam, Commvault ou NetBackup. Garantimos no mínimo 50% de desconto, com mais funcionalidades.
Heitor Faria · [email protected] · +1 789 726-1749 · +55 61 98268-4220 (WhatsApp)
Disponível em:
Português
English (Inglês)
Español (Espanhol)